Talend Data Quality Pack#1

After completing this training course, you will be able to develop your jobs using the power of the advanced software components and Java; you will also be able to analyze your data and maximize quality.

Even though knowledge of SQL is the only prerequisite to qualify for this training course, business knowledge will be needed to interpret the analyses related to data quality. Knowledge of the Java language is a plus.

Always based on real use cases, this five day training course allows you to master the Talend Data Quality software to analyze the data and to clean it.
